What counts as duplicate content?

Discussion in 'Search Engine Optimization' started by petes1980, May 6, 2009.

  1. #1
    Got a query regarding duplicate content, how similar does a page have to be to be classed as duplicate content? I have info pages on products through different models of cars. These pages are identical in structure as its the type of information, just for different car types. I used a duplicate checker website and got the following results:

    HTML fingerprint: 100%
    HTML distribution value: 99.18%
    Total HTML similarity: 99.59%
    Standard text similarity: 79.86%
    Smart text similarity: 61.72%
    Total text similarity: 70.79%


    As you can see it has picked up that the page structure is the same, but the text is only similar. Do you think this would be classed as duplicate content?

    The problem is i am talking about the same products in each page, just on different cars, so there is always going to be similar content, just don't want to get penilised for it.
